In pedestrian accidents, the injuries sustained can range from minor scrapes to life-altering traumas. Due to the lack of protection compared to vehicle occupants, pedestrians are more susceptible to severe harm. Common injuries include fractures, head and brain injuries, spinal cord damage, and lacerations.Â
These injuries not only lead to immediate pain and medical expenses but can also result in long-term physical therapy, rehabilitation, and, sometimes, permanent disability. The emotional and psychological impact, including trauma and PTSD, can also be profound, adding another layer of complexity to the recovery process. New Jersey streets see a significant number of pedestrian accidents annually. According to recent data, pedestrians account for a disproportionate number of traffic fatalities at 30 percent statewide. New Jersey law has clear regulations designed to protect pedestrians. For instance, drivers are required to stop for pedestrians at marked crosswalks. However, pedestrians also have responsibilities, such as not jaywalking and ensuring they cross streets at appropriate locations.
Liability in New Jersey is determined by the doctrine of comparative negligence. This means if a pedestrian is found to be partially responsible for the accident, any compensation they might receive will be reduced by the percentage of their fault, making it essential to have a strong legal defense backing you as an injured victim. Furthermore, it’s crucial to act swiftly. New Jersey imposes a two-year statute of limitations for personal injury claims. This means that from the date of your accident, you have only two years to initiate legal proceedings.

In New Jersey, like many states, drivers are required to have auto insurance, which typically includes coverage for accidents involving pedestrians. When an accident occurs, the at-fault driver’s insurance is often the first source of compensation for the injured pedestrian.
However, insurance companies might attempt to minimize payouts or argue fault. That’s why it’s imperative to have legal representation to navigate these discussions and negotiations, ensuring that victims are not unfairly burdened or left without adequate compensation. In some cases, a pedestrian’s personal insurance might also come into play, especially if the at-fault driver is underinsured or uninsured.
